Polish referees Bartosz Frankowski and Tomasz Musial, who were supposed to work on VAR in today's Champions League 3rd qualifying round match between Dynamo and Rangers, were arrested by police for stealing a road sign.

According to Tvp.pl, the men were drunk and stole the road sign.

"Around 01:40, we received a report that three men were carrying a road sign down the street. Police officers were sent to the scene and found the men intoxicated. The violators had more than 1.5 ppm of alcohol in their blood. They were taken to a medical sobering-up center," the press officer of the Main Department of the Municipal Police in Lublin said in a statement.

UEFA, in turn, has already responded to this scandal by replacing these referees. Tomasz Kwiatkowski and Pawel Malec will now work the match.
